Three hurt in Carol Stream brawl
Carol Stream police continue to investigate a fight early Sunday morning that sent three people to the hospital, including one with a puncture wound in his back and another with a broken nose.
The brawl started around 1:15 a.m. outside the Jade Asian Infused Restaurant on the 1000 block of Fountainview Drive, authorities said.
Police said there was a large crowd at the scene when they arrived and Glendale Heights police were called to assist.
The man with the stab wound was attending a party at Flip Flops Tiki Bar and Grill across the street, police said. Owner Chris Sabalaskey said the brawl broke out after a couple of men were harassing some women.
"Someone said 'Knock it off' and a fight broke out," Sabalaskey said.
"More than one fight was going on," Deputy Chief Jerry O'Brien said. "People were going back and forth between both places."
The officers found three injured people when they arrived and called for ambulances. One man was hit in the head with a bottle during the melee.
The three injured people were taken to Central DuPage Hospital in Winfield. Two of the men were treated and released while the man with the stab wound was kept overnight for observation, police said.
O'Brien said the wound didn't appear to be made by a knife but investigators still had not determined exactly what was used.
Village President Frank Saverino, who heads the liquor commission, said there were no previous problems with either restaurant. He said he will not decide whether the liquor commission should take any action until all the reports are completed.
However, he said initial reports indicate none of the employees at either establishment did anything wrong.
